Northern line in Barnet
High Barnet branch
Runs north from Camden Town through Finchley to the end of the line at High Barnet, and is the branch most of the borough east of the A1 depends on.
| Station | Zone | Toilets |
|---|---|---|
| East Finchley | 3 | No |
| Finchley Central | 4 | Yes |
| West Finchley | 4 | Yes |
| Woodside Park | 4 | Yes |
| Totteridge & Whetstone | 4 | Yes |
| High Barnet | 5 | Yes |
Mill Hill East branch
A single-track spur off Finchley Central, and one of the shortest branches on the Underground. Trains are usually a shuttle rather than a through service.
| Station | Zone | Toilets |
|---|---|---|
| Mill Hill East | 4 | No |
Edgware branch
Runs north-west through Golders Green and Hendon to Edgware, serving the west of the borough and the Brent Cross regeneration area.
| Station | Zone | Toilets |
|---|---|---|
| Golders Green | 3 | No |
| Brent Cross | 3 | No |
| Hendon Central | 3/4 | No |
| Colindale | 4 | No |
| Burnt Oak | 4 | No |
| Edgware | 5 | No |

Which Tube line serves Barnet?
The Northern line. Thirteen of its stations are inside the London Borough of Barnet, across three branches: the High Barnet branch through Finchley, the Edgware branch through Golders Green and Hendon, and the short Mill Hill East spur off Finchley Central. No other Underground line runs through the borough.
Which zone is High Barnet in?
High Barnet is in Zone 5, at the northern end of the Northern line. Edgware, at the end of the other branch, is also Zone 5. The borough spans Zones 3 to 5, with Golders Green, Brent Cross and East Finchley in Zone 3.
Does the Elizabeth line stop in Barnet?
No. The Elizabeth line does not run through the London Borough of Barnet. The nearest options are the Northern line, or Thameslink from Mill Hill Broadway and Hendon.
Why is the Mill Hill East branch so short?
It is a single-track spur running one stop from Finchley Central, and services on it are usually run as a shuttle rather than through to central London. It is among the shortest branches on the Underground.
